Bibliothèques écrites en Assembly

Apollo-11

Code source original de l'ordinateur de guidage Apollo 11 (AGC) pour les modules de commande et lunaire.
  • 53.1k
  • GNU General Public License v3.0

MS-DOS

Les sources originales de MS-DOS 1.25 et 2.0, à des fins de référence.
  • 15.6k
  • GNU General Public License v3.0

MalwareSourceCode

Collection de code source de logiciels malveillants pour une variété de plates-formes dans un éventail de langages de programmation différents.
  • 10.5k

mal

mal - Faire un Lisp.
  • 8.8k
  • GNU General Public License v3.0

hello-world

Bonjour tout le monde dans tous les langages informatiques. Merci à tous ceux qui contribuent à cela, assurez-vous de voir contribuer.md pour les instructions de contribution!.
  • 8.3k
  • MIT

Reverse-Engineering-Tutorial

Un didacticiel complet GRATUIT de rétro-ingénierie couvrant les architectures x86, x64, ARM 32 bits et ARM 64 bits.
  • 7.1k
  • Apache License 2.0

Prince-of-Persia-Apple-II

Un jeu de course-saut-combat à l'épée que j'ai créé sur l'Apple II de 1985 à 1989.
  • 6.0k
  • GNU General Public License v3.0

unix-history-repo

Historique continu des commits Unix de 1970 à aujourd'hui.
  • 5.7k
  • GNU General Public License v3.0

pics

Affiches, dessins....
  • 5.6k

x86-bare-metal-examples

Dozens of minimal operating systems to learn x86 system programming. Tested on Ubuntu 17.10 host in QEMU 2.10 and real hardware. Userland cheat at: https://github.com/cirosantilli/linux-kernel-module-cheat#userland-assembly ARM baremetal setup at: https://github.com/cirosantilli/linux-kernel-module-cheat#baremetal-setup 学习x86系统编程的数十个最小操作系统。 已在QEMU 2.10中的Ubuntu 17.10主机和真实硬件上进行了测试。 Userland作弊网址:https://github.com/cirosantilli/linux-kernel-module-cheat#userland-assembly ARM裸机安装程序位于:https://github.c.
  • 4.1k
  • GNU General Public License v3.0

BLAKE3

les implémentations officielles Rust et C de la fonction de hachage cryptographique BLAKE3.
  • 3.5k
  • GNU General Public License v3.0

pokered

Démontage de Pokémon Rouge/Bleu.
  • 3.1k

asmttpd

Serveur Web pour Linux écrit en assembleur amd64..
  • 2.9k
  • GNU General Public License v3.0 only

rav1e

L'encodeur AV1 le plus rapide et le plus sûr.

ring

Petite crypto sûre et rapide utilisant Rust (par briansmith).

cpuminer

Mineur CPU pour Litecoin et Bitcoin.
  • 2.5k
  • GNU General Public License v3.0

virtualagc

Logiciel Virtual Apollo Guidance Computer (AGC).
  • 2.2k
  • GNU General Public License v3.0

algorithm-archive

Un livre collaboratif sur les algorithmes.
  • 2.0k
  • MIT

malware_training_vol1

Matériel pour la formation à l'analyse des logiciels malveillants Windows (volume 1).
  • 1.7k

pokecrystal

Démontage de Pokémon Cristal.
  • 1.7k

VexRiscv

Une implémentation de processeur RISC-V 32 bits compatible FPGA.
  • 1.6k
  • MIT

reedsolomon

Codage d'effacement Reed-Solomon dans Go.

bootOS

bootOS est un système d'exploitation monolithique en 512 octets de code machine x86.
  • 1.4k
  • BSD 2-clause "Simplified"

wide-snes

Projet écran large Super Mario World (SNES).
  • 1.3k

KnightOS

OS pour les calculatrices z80.
  • 1.2k
  • GNU General Public License v3.0

mu

L'âme d'une toute nouvelle machine. Des tests plus approfondis → Des logiciels plus compréhensibles et faciles à réécrire → Une société plus résiliente. (par akkartik).
  • 1.2k
  • GNU General Public License v3.0

cemu_graphic_packs

Packs graphiques communautaires pour Cemu.
  • 1.1k
  • Creative Commons Zero v1.0 Universal

DOOM-FX

Doom/FX pour Super Nintendo avec SuperFX GSU2A.
  • 1.0k
  • GNU General Public License v3.0 only

HelloSilicon

Une introduction à l'assemblage ARM64 sur les Mac Apple Silicon.
  • 932
  • MIT

floppybird

Oiseau disquette (OS).
  • 870
  • MIT